Toyota Urban Cruiser Hyryder G E-CNG vs S Hybrid: is the step up worth it?

Moving up costs you ₹1.46L ex-showroom Delhi: ₹17.18L for the S Hybrid against ₹15.72L for the G E-CNG.+₹1.46L

There is no like-for-like way up here: the cheapest S Hybrid moves from CNG 5-speed manual to Hybrid e-CVT automatic, so that figure covers the powertrain as well as the kit.

The full story

Moving up costs you ₹1.46L ex-showroom Delhi: ₹17.18L for the S Hybrid against ₹15.72L for the G E-CNG.

There is no like-for-like way up here: the cheapest S Hybrid moves from CNG 5-speed manual to Hybrid e-CVT automatic, so that figure covers the powertrain as well as the kit.

For that you get drive modes, driver display (7" digital against Semi-digital) and regenerative braking.

It is not all one way: the S Hybrid gives up headlamps (LED projector against Halogen), ventilated front seats, touchscreen (9" against 7") and speakers (6 against 4), and 8 more.

G E-CNG or S Hybrid, and what each costs

Where you start

G E-CNG

₹15.72L ex-showroom Delhi

A CNG rarity: ventilated seats, the 9-inch screen and wireless charging with CNG running costs. You give up the panoramic sunroof and any automatic.

The step up

S Hybrid

₹17.18L ex-showroom Delhi

The affordable door into the strong hybrid: S kit with drive modes and silent electric running in town, no plug ever needed.

G E-CNG vs S Hybrid: the questions people ask

Is the Toyota Urban Cruiser Hyryder S Hybrid worth ₹1.46L over the G E-CNG?
For ₹1.46L you get drive modes and driver display (7" digital against Semi-digital), on top of 1 other thing the G E-CNG goes without. You would give up headlamps (LED projector against Halogen) and ventilated front seats, and 10 more.
What does the Toyota Urban Cruiser Hyryder S Hybrid have that the G E-CNG does not?
It adds drive modes, driver display (7" digital against Semi-digital) and regenerative braking, and it opens up the Hybrid.
What does the Toyota Urban Cruiser Hyryder S Hybrid give up against the G E-CNG?
It gives up headlamps (LED projector against Halogen), ventilated front seats, touchscreen (9" against 7"), speakers (6 against 4), auto headlamps and wireless phone charger, and 6 more. Worth weighing against what it adds before deciding the dearer trim is simply the better car.
How much is the Toyota Urban Cruiser Hyryder G E-CNG?
₹15.72L ex-showroom Delhi, and it is sold one way only: the G E-CNG CNG MT.
How much is the Toyota Urban Cruiser Hyryder S Hybrid?
₹17.18L ex-showroom Delhi, and it is sold one way only: the S Hybrid Hybrid AT.
Is there an automatic G E-CNG or S Hybrid?
Only the S Hybrid, from ₹17.18L ex-showroom Delhi. The G E-CNG is sold with a manual gearbox only, so wanting two pedals decides this one for you.
